Season 2, Episode 6 - Why Does Your Child With FASD Lie? 12.02.2021

In this week's episode we open up the conversation around this very tricky aspect of living with FASD. So many parents, carers, teachers and other professionals really struggle with what feels like being lied to, we talk about what it really is and how we make the adjustments required to handle it. With Clare Devanney Glynn and Jessica Rutherford.

Season 2, Episode 3 - Martin Clarke, A Social Worker's Take On FASD 22.01.2021

This week we talk to Martin Clarke and listen to his wonderfully honest take on FASDs and Social Work. Martin has over 25 years of experience as a social worker in child protection and has spent the last 14 years delivering FASDs training on behalf of TACT  to foster carers and other professionals. Episode 5 - No Shame, No Blame 13.11.2020

In this weeks episode we're highlighting the message at the core of everything we do. There's still a stigma hovering around FASD due to it being caused by prenatal alcohol exposure, but we want to open conversations in ways that project absolutely no shame or blame.
